Transaction 4c39640606c8d3dfce4d924fd43a17109eaff09b7530707a9c7f1167b22255aa
1 Input
1 Output
-
4c39640606c8d3dfce4d924fd43a17109eaff09b7530707a9c7f1167b22255aa:0
- value
- 424003907
- script pubkey
- OP_0 OP_PUSHBYTES_20 89b4d973c6530ba3bc4def89929179e6fd97fdc7
- address
- bc1q3x6dju7x2v9680zda7ye9yteum7e0lw8z5cszs